Kio estas la diferenco inter Unikso kaj shell scripting?

Male al Unikso, ĝi estas senpaga kaj malfermfonta. Bash kaj zsh estas konkoj. Ŝelo estas komandlinia interfaco (CLI). … Ĉar ŝeloj fariĝis pli altnivelaj, pli kompleksa programado fariĝis havebla en ŝelaj skriptoj, sed ĝi ankoraŭ esence efektivigas komandojn kiel vi entajpis ilin.

Kio estas Unikso kaj shell scripting?

Unikso-simila ŝelo estas komandlinia interpretisto aŭ ŝelo kiu disponigas komandlinian uzantinterfacon por Unikso-similaj operaciumoj. La ŝelo estas kaj interaga komandlingvo kaj skriptlingvo, kaj estas uzata de la operaciumo por kontroli la ekzekuton de la sistemo uzante ŝelmanuskriptojn.

Kio estas diferenco inter Shell kaj bash scripting?

Bash ( bash ) estas unu el multaj disponeblaj (tamen la plej ofte uzataj) Uniksaj ŝeloj. … Shell scripting estas scripting en ajna ŝelo, dum Bash scripting estas scripting specife por Bash. En la praktiko, tamen, "ŝelo-skripto" kaj "bash-skripto" estas ofte uzataj interŝanĝeble, krom se la koncerna ŝelo ne estas Bash.

Kio estas la ĉefa diferenco inter Unikso kaj Linukso?

Diferenco inter Linukso kaj Unikso

komparo linux Unikso
operaciumo Linukso estas nur la kerno. Unikso estas kompleta pako de operaciumo.
Sekureco Ĝi provizas pli altan sekurecon. Linukso havas ĉirkaŭ 60-100 virusojn listigitaj ĝis nun. Unikso ankaŭ estas tre sekurigita. Ĝi havas proksimume 85-120 virusojn listigitaj ĝis nun

Por kio estas uzataj ŝelaj skriptoj?

Ŝelaj skriptoj permesas al ni programi komandojn en ĉenoj kaj havi la sistemon ekzekuti ilin kiel skripto-evento, same kiel bataj dosieroj. Ili ankaŭ permesas multe pli utilajn funkciojn, kiel komand-anstataŭigo. Vi povas alvoki komandon, kiel dato, kaj uzi ĝian produktaĵon kiel parto de dosiernoma skemo.

Kiu Unikso-ŝelo estas plej bona?

Bash estas bonega ĉiuflanka, kun bonega dokumentado, dum Zsh aldonas kelkajn funkciojn al ĝi por fari ĝin eĉ pli bona. Fiŝo estas mirinda por novuloj kaj helpas ilin lerni la komandlinion. Ksh kaj Tcsh pli taŭgas por progresintaj uzantoj, kiuj bezonas kelkajn el siaj pli potencaj skriptkapabloj.

Kio estas $? En Unikso?

$? -La elira stato de la lasta komando efektivigita. $0 -La dosiernomo de la nuna skripto. $# -La nombro da argumentoj provizitaj al skripto. $$ -La proceza numero de la nuna ŝelo. Por ŝelaj skriptoj, ĉi tiu estas la proceza ID sub kiu ili plenumas.

Kiu estas pli rapida Bash aŭ Python?

Bash-ŝelprogramado estas la defaŭlta terminalo en la plej multaj Linuksaj distribuoj kaj tiel ĝi ĉiam estos pli rapida laŭ rendimento. … Shell Scripting estas simpla, kaj ĝi ne estas tiel potenca kiel python. Ĝi ne traktas kadrojn kaj estas malfacile ekiri kun retejo rilataj programoj uzante Shell Scripting.

Ĉu mi uzu sh aŭ bash?

bash kaj sh estas du malsamaj konkoj. Esence bash estas sh, kun pli da funkcioj kaj pli bona sintakso. … Bash signifas “Bourne Again SHell”, kaj estas anstataŭaĵo/plibonigo de la origina Bourne-ŝelo (sh). Ŝelo-skripto estas skribado en iu ajn ŝelo, dum Bash-skripto estas skribado specife por Bash.

Kio estas $1 en bash-skripto?

$1 estas la unua komandlinia argumento transdonita al la ŝela skripto. Ankaŭ sciu kiel Poziciaj parametroj. … $0 estas la nomo de la skripto mem (script.sh) $1 estas la unua argumento (dosiernomo1) $2 estas la dua argumento (dir1)

Ĉu Unikso 2020 ankoraŭ estas uzata?

Tamen malgraŭ la fakto, ke la kvazaŭa malkresko de UNIX daŭre venas, ĝi ankoraŭ spiras. Ĝi ankoraŭ estas vaste uzata en entreprenaj datumcentroj. Ĝi ankoraŭ funkcias grandegajn, kompleksajn, ŝlosilajn aplikojn por kompanioj, kiuj absolute, pozitive bezonas tiujn programojn por funkcii.

Kie Unikso estas uzata hodiaŭ?

Unikso estas operaciumo. Ĝi subtenas multitasking kaj multi-uzanto funkciojn. Unikso estas plej vaste uzata en ĉiuj formoj de komputilaj sistemoj kiel labortablo, tekokomputilo kaj serviloj. En Unikso, ekzistas Grafika uzantinterfaco simila al fenestroj, kiuj subtenas facilan navigadon kaj subtenan medion.

Ĉu Vindoza Unikso similas?

Krom la operaciumoj bazitaj en Windows NT de Microsoft, preskaŭ ĉio alia spuras sian heredaĵon reen al Unikso. Linukso, Mac OS X, Android, iOS, Chrome OS, Orbis OS uzataj sur PlayStation 4, kia ajn firmvaro funkcias sur via enkursigilo - ĉiuj ĉi tiuj operaciumoj ofte estas nomitaj "Uniks-similaj" operaciumoj.

Ĉu Shell Scripting ankoraŭ estas uzata?

Kaj jes, estas multe da uzo por ŝelaj skriptoj hodiaŭ, ĉar la ŝelo ĉiam ekzistas en ĉiuj uniksoj, el la skatolo, male al perl, python, csh, zsh, ksh (eble?), ktp. Plejofte ili nur aldonas kroman oportunon aŭ malsaman sintakson por konstruaĵoj kiel bukloj kaj testoj.

Ĉu Shell Scripting estas facile lernebla?

Nu, kun bona kompreno pri Komputado, la tiel nomata "praktika programado" ne estas tiom malfacile lernebla. … Bash-programado estas tre simpla. Vi devus lerni lingvojn kiel C kaj tiel plu; ŝelprogramado estas sufiĉe bagatela kompare kun ĉi tiuj.

Ĉu Python estas ŝela skripto?

Python estas interpretista lingvo. Ĝi signifas, ke ĝi efektivigas la kodon linion post linio. Python provizas Python Shell, kiu estas uzata por efektivigi ununuran Python-komando kaj montri la rezulton. … Por ruli la Python-ŝelon, malfermu la komandan promptilon aŭ potenco-ŝelon ĉe Vindozo kaj fina fenestro ĉe mac, skribu python kaj premu enen.

Ĉu vi ŝatas ĉi tiun afiŝon? Bonvolu dividi al viaj amikoj:
OS Hodiaŭ